Just to confirm... Did you draw a rectangle before using the plotter?  The 
function-plotter requires you to select a plotting area before you tell it to 
render a function.  In other words, please could you confirm that you use the 
tool as follows:
* Draw a rectangle
* Select the rectangle
* Choose the function plotter extension, enter details and hit "Apply".

I also noticed a couple of potential problems with your input fields:
* You're only using 2 samples... i.e. your sine curve will only contain two 
data points.
* You selected a y-range of 0:1 but the sine function has a range of -1:1.  
This means that the curve will extended below the bottom of your selected 
drawing rectangle.
